50664384033410000 is an even composite number. It is composed of five distinct prime numbers multiplied together. It has a total of one thousand, three hundred fifty divisors.

Prime factorization of 50664384033410000:

24 × 54 × 72 × 295 × 712

(2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 5 × 5 × 5 × 5 × 7 × 7 × 29 × 29 × 29 × 29 × 29 × 71 × 71)
